      It might sound simple, but when panning isolate and rotate at the hips. Then start your shot with your body twisted and let it naturally come back to the neutral position (facing forward with knees and hips squared-up). Often times untwisting is a smoother movement than twisting 'into' to movement (if that makes sense.)
